Barry Faudemer
Barry Faudemer served as the former head of enforcement at the Jersey Financial Services Commission, where he expressed concerns regarding the reputational risks associated with granting residency to Russian billionaire Roman Abramovich, citing fears of potential corruption and money laundering linked to the oligarch's close ties with the Kremlin.
